For me playing a blade takes away the essential "bardiness" of being a bard. What use is having a bard if they can't use amazing songs? I think bard song is very useful at high levels (I know that this problem with blades can be countered by using HLA's in ToB, but that seems more of a loophole in the game than anything). Also blades are useless at identifying things, a very useful property of bards early on in the game. But in general it depends on your RP style, I think they aren't proper bards but some people think they rock.

Hi Zoltan,

The only question about Blade vs. Skald is: do you have, or are you going to get, ToB? If yes: go with the Blade. If no: go with the Skald.

At high (ToB) levels, you'll get a chance to upgrade your Blade's song to one which surpasses a Skald's song.

In the mean time, offensive spin rocks!
